Output 3908b6532013ebd9cb0750983dc884dcda98642874b5212c75ff45aa9d9ac485:7

value
2130618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66840ff2e214a0ef04e68a0d595b93f356bfcb6d OP_EQUAL
address
3B353xdQMpUaWb2CV2ctQDzawtPegpLQnU
transaction
3908b6532013ebd9cb0750983dc884dcda98642874b5212c75ff45aa9d9ac485
spent
true